Analysis
The most recent figure for private health expenditure per person in Cameroon is 173.81, measured in 2023. That is the highest value across all 24 years on record.
The figure is up 5.4% on the previous year and up 86.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, private health expenditure per person in Cameroon peaked at 173.81 in 2023 and was at its lowest, 67.8, in 2002.
Cameroon ranks 134th of 193 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 24 years of available data.
Private health expenditure per person in Cameroon,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2000 | 74.66 | — |
| 2001 | 72.32 | -3.1% |
| 2002 | 67.8 | -6.2% |
| 2003 | 69.91 | +3.1% |
| 2004 | 73.39 | +5.0% |
| 2005 | 76.4 | +4.1% |
| 2006 | 78.82 | +3.2% |
| 2007 | 85.5 | +8.5% |
| 2008 | 82.79 | -3.2% |
| 2009 | 82.11 | -0.8% |
| 2010 | 84.06 | +2.4% |
| 2011 | 84.03 | -0.0% |
| 2012 | 91.24 | +8.6% |
| 2013 | 93.46 | +2.4% |
| 2014 | 114.65 | +22.7% |
| 2015 | 119.13 | +3.9% |
| 2016 | 119.81 | +0.6% |
| 2017 | 125.44 | +4.7% |
| 2018 | 110.34 | -12.0% |
| 2019 | 117.41 | +6.4% |
| 2020 | 139.3 | +18.6% |
| 2021 | 153.41 | +10.1% |
| 2022 | 164.91 | +7.5% |
| 2023 | 173.81 | +5.4% |
